This commit aligns the frontend wUSDT implementation with the SDK runtime
constants, ensuring consistency across the entire stack.
Changes:
- Update ASSET_IDS.WUSDT from 2 → 1000 (matches SDK constants)
- Add ASSET_CONFIGS with wUSDT configuration (6 decimals, min balance)
- Update all asset queries in AccountBalance.tsx to use ASSET_IDS.WUSDT
- Update pool queries for wHEZ/wUSDT and PEZ/wUSDT pools
- Update USDTBridge.tsx burn transaction to use ASSET_IDS.WUSDT
- Refactor usdt.ts to reference ASSET_CONFIGS instead of hardcoded values
Asset ID Allocation Strategy:
- 0-999: Reserved for protocol tokens (wHEZ, PEZ, etc.)
- 1000+: Bridged/wrapped external assets (wUSDT, etc.)
Technical Details:
- wUSDT uses 6 decimals (USDT standard), not 12 like native HEZ
- All frontend code now uses centralized ASSET_CONFIGS
- ESLint passes with 0 errors (8 pre-existing warnings unrelated to changes)
